Osteochondritis Dissecans (OCD) is the most common cause of pain on outside of elbow in young athletes. OCD is caused by repetitive overhead motion e.g. baseball, gymnastics and weightlifting.

Your doctor may recommend the following self-care measures: Rest. Avoid activities that aggravate your elbow pain. Pain relievers. Try over-the-counter pain relievers, such as ibuprofen (Advil, Motrin IB) or naproxen (Aleve). Ice. Apply ice or a cold pack for 15 minutes three to four times a day. certified bank trainer iibf
